Choosing a Double Glazing Company Near Me

Double glazing is an excellent investment. The cost of your windows and installation could be significantly affected by choosing the best company.

Local DIY stores are usually in a position to recommend customers to trusted contractors and offer discounted products. Safestyle UK, for example is among the largest FENSA registered companies and has a Trustpilot score of 4.2.

uPVC

uPVC provides a long-lasting, durable product with low maintenance, and excellent fire resistance. It is a good material for insulation since it helps keep heat inside your home during winter and cools it down in summer. It does not require coatings such as aluminum frames to stop rust and corrosion. Furthermore, uPVC is impervious to mold and rot and does not require regular cleaning.

Local directories of businesses, online directories and local business listings are excellent ways to find double-glazing businesses in your area. They usually include basic business information and may feature customer testimonials. These reviews can provide an insight into the quality of customer service and professionalism of a business. It can help you determine if the company is suitable for your requirements.

A dependable uPVC installer will always give you a precise quote and offer flexible payment options. In addition, they will offer you an FENSA certificate and a product warranty to guarantee the quality of their work. Additionally, they must check in with you a few weeks after installation to make sure that you are satisfied with the work.

One of the most reputable UK double glazing companies is Anglian Windows that has been operating for half 100 years. It is a market leader that places an emphasis on sustainability in the context of economics and the environment. Its products bear the Made in Britain mark and are part of the Recovinyl Plus initiative for PVC recycling. The company has a high online rating and offers an extensive range of door and window designs.

Another highly rated UK-based company is Safestyle UK, which was established in 1992 and specializes in uPVC doors and windows. Its products come in a variety of shapes and styles, including Scandinavian-inspired designs. Customers who are on a tight budget will be attracted to the fair option of financing and payment options. Furthermore, it has numerous accreditations and offers outstanding customer reviews.

Energy efficiency

If you're considering replacing your doors or windows with uPVC double glazing, consider choosing energy-efficient options. This will save you money on your heating bills and increase the value of your home. double glazing Replacement windows-glazed windows are also stronger and less likely to break than single panes of glass, meaning you can feel confident that your home is safe. Additionally the heat-insulating properties uPVC stop noise from outside or from neighbours from entering your home.

Double glazed windows are comprised of two glass panes with a gap between them and are renowned for reducing energy bills by up to 64 percent in a typical family home. They stop your home from getting too hot in summer and keep the heat in the winter. Ecostar UPVC double-glazed windows are made with Low-E glass and come with a 10-year guarantee to ensure you're getting a top-quality product.

Asking your family and friends for recommendations or analyzing online reviews can help you identify a reputable double glazing company. You can judge a company's professionalism and customer service by reading the reviews. For example the Essex-based Crystal Home Improvements has an excellent customer review and provides the 'Buy Now Pay Later' financing option for its customers.

A second way to evaluate the double glazing company is to check its memberships and accreditations, such as the FENSA Made in Britain and Forest Stewardship Council. The company must also have a track record of installing double-glazing. It must also have a specific email address and telephone number so you can contact them easily. Also, a reputable double-glazing company will contact you with a courtesy call a few weeks after the installation to check if you're satisfied with their work.

Styles

Double glazing can enhance the value of your home, improve efficiency in energy use and reduce noise pollution. If you're looking for windows or replace double glazing glass ones you have you can pick from a wide range of styles. They are available in a variety of colors and materials to fit your home. Some of the most sought-after windows are Georgian bar, Georgian sash and casement windows.

Double-glazed windows are made up of two panes separated by a space in between. The space is then sealed to form an insulated unit. They are more durable and difficult to break than single windows, and can be made of laminated or toughened glass to provide extra security. The properties of insulation will also help keep your house warmer by blocking cold air.

The frames are available in a range of materials, including traditional timber, uPVC or aluminium. Timber frames are more expensive but they add a touch of class to the property, particularly in period buildings.

Sliding sash windows are a different option, with the ability to slide from left to right along a track. They are especially popular in older properties and can be coated with a variety of colours and finishes. Georgian bars are a style of window which incorporates horizontal and vertical bars into the glass to give a traditional look that can be combined with many frames.

When choosing a double-glazing firm, it is crucial to find out whether they belong to any professional bodies and have positive customer reviews. This will ensure that you get a high quality installation at a reasonable cost. Find out if the company offers discounts and financing on their products. This could save you money over the course of time.

Materials

Double glazing comes in various styles and double glazing Replacement windows materials. From uPVC frames to timber or aluminium frames. The most suitable choice will depend on your needs such as budget and aesthetic preferences. Also, you should be aware of the energy rating for your windows and doors. This is a measurement of the degree to which a window blocks heat and cold. A high energy rating will save you money on heating and cooling costs. Double glazing also helps reduce harmful UV rays that cause fading of wood, images and furniture.

The most popular type of double glazing is made up of two glass panes, with an insulation gap between them. The gap is typically 14mm-16mm thick and can be filled with argon or air gas, which has excellent insulating properties. The frame material you select is also important, as some materials are more durable than other. Some frames are made of glasses that have been laminated or tempered while others are designed to resist fire. Some double-glazed units are made to prevent condensation and provide noise reduction.

Double glazing can enhance the value of your home, and also increase its energy efficiency and noise reduction. The right double-glazed windows will make your home more comfortable, which can lead to reduced dependence on central heating systems. This will save you a significant amount of money on your energy bills throughout the year.

When choosing a firm for your double-glazing, look for certifications like FENSA or TrustMark which can assist you in determining the quality of their products and services. In addition, the best companies should offer a range of deals, including a free consultation and low-rate financing.

Installation

Double glazing can help reduce your energy costs, make you home warmer and quieter and improve the value of your home. It also improves indoor air quality and gives you peace of that your home is a secure place to live. However, the cost of installation can vary greatly depending on the company you choose and how many windows you will need to install. It is worth to compare prices from local and national companies as well as checking their reviews on the internet.

When choosing a double-glazing installer, look for one with a good reputation and excellent customer service. Some of the most trusted firms include Everest, Anglian and Safestyle. They offer a variety of options, competitive prices and no-cost upgrades to triple-glazing. They can also provide a quick turnaround, and will frequently visit your home to give you a quote.

A reputable firm will always be honest about their costs and should never try to hide extra fees. You should receive a thorough breakdown of their costs, including the price of labor. They will be happy to answer any questions you may have, so don't be afraid to ask questions. It is recommended to keep a record of all communications or emails you have with the company, as well as pictures of any damage or defective installations.

If you're on a tight budget you can apply for a grant that will assist you in paying for double glazing. The government scheme ECO4 offers financial assistance to help you save energy by making home improvements, including double glazing. This is available to homeowners on low incomes and is available for through your energy supplier. You can also apply for LA Flex, which is a Green Deal loan that is paid back through energy bills.
